In 1887, Anthony Hall entered the world in Newcastle Upon Tyne, Northumberland, England, born to Anthony Hall and Elizabeth Gallon. Anthony Hall married Rachel Annie Graham Scott, and had children including Robert Alexander Hall, John Hall, Elizabeth Hall. Anthony Hall passed away in 1950 in Newcastle Upon Tyne.
